This family in Texas (can't remember the city) asked their neighbor, who is the Mayor of the town- to pet sit their little shih-tzu for the weekend while they went out of town.  The mayor didn't like the look of the dog- she alleges, covered in fleas and suffering from flea anemia- hair loss, unkempt appearance etc... Anyway- so she takes the dog- tells the family (they have young children too) that the dog died and that she buried it in the backyard.  A few days later, the family heard the dog barking! Now they have to go to court to try and get their dog back.  Meredith Viera interviewed both the family and the mayor- she asked the Mayor why she just didn't report the family to the animal control and you know what her response was? " I didn't want to get Shelly (the owner) in trouble"  How lame is that!
